They use about 1/2 qt week. My dealer broke down the one with 400 hrs. Dirt has gotten in around the intake on the head and there are no signs of dirt from the air filter to the intake. KAW told them dirt can only come in from air filter but there are no signs of a dirt trail. KAW said not there problem but it is still in warranty.

Got a Kawi 31HP (Super Z 72" side discharge) with 150hrs and it doesn't use oil. I changed the oil at 11hrs then every 50hrs after that. Changed the outer air filter once so far. With the outer and inner air filter I find it hard that dirt made it's way through. The inner still looks new.
When you say dirt gotten in around the intake is he thinking the intake gasket? Could the engine got hot and warped something? Fins cleaned? I would imagine that the rear discharge decks could kick more dirt/grass to the engine area. |
